With the Euro 2016 tournament in full swing, SBC brings some interesting bite-size facts about some of this week’s games, as provided by iSportGenius.
Spain vs Czech Republic
• At UEFA Euro 2012, after conceding in the 61st minute of its first match, Spain went the rest of the tournament (509 minutes) without allowing another goal
• Spain is unbeaten in its four internationals against the Czech Republic, winning three of them
• The Czech Republic has only scored one goal across its four internationals against Spain
Republic of Ireland vs Sweden
• In its last 16 UEFA Euro matches, Sweden has scored just two first-half goals compared to 21 after the break
• Zlatan Ibrahimovic scored in eight of Sweden’s last nine qualifying matches for this year’s UEFA Euro tournament
• Including friendlies, across its last six internationals against the Republic of Ireland, Sweden has only scored one goal in the first half
Belgium vs Italy
• Four of Italy’s last eight UEFA Euro Group Stage matches have resulted in a 1-1 draw
• Eden Hazard scored one goal in each of Belgium’s last four UEFA Euro qualifying fixtures
• Six red cards were awarded during Italy’s qualification matches for this year’s tournament
Austria vs Hungary
• Marc Janko scored in five of Austria’s last six UEFA Euro qualifying matches
• Including friendlies, Austria has only won two of its last 15 internationals against Hungary
• Including friendlies, both teams scored in five of the last six internationals between Austria and Hungary
Portugal vs Iceland
• Each of Portugal’s last seven fixtures during UEFA Euro qualifying resulted in a one-goal win
• Cristiano Ronaldo has scored each of Portugal’s last three goals at the UEFA Euro championships
• Portugal has won both of its two previous international meetings with Iceland, scoring a combined eight goals in the process
